Abstract: A method of generating a data set includes determining a vertex count of a reference polygonal mesh, generating a second polygonal mesh by adding a predetermined number of vertices to the reference polygonal mesh, comparing a representation of the second polygonal mesh with a representation of the reference polygonal mesh, assigning a first value of a quality parameter to the reference polygonal mesh, and assigning a second value of the quality parameter to the second polygonal mesh based on the comparison of the representations, the value of the quality parameter for a given polygonal mesh indicative of a degree of difference between a representation of the given polygonal mesh and a representation of the reference polygonal mesh, and generating the data set comprising data indicative of a vertex count for the reference and second polygonal meshes and a value of a quality parameters for the reference and second polygonal meshes.

Abstract: A cone for use in a Pepper's Ghost illusion includes a conical wall of semi-reflective material, and an attachment member for removably attaching the cone to the surface of a light emissive display, and a method of displaying a Pepper's Ghost illusion includes positioning a cone of semi-reflective material onto a light emissive display; and displaying on the light emissive display an image that has been distorted by an inverse of a distortion caused by a reflection of the cone.

Abstract: A system for restricting user motion using a robot includes a robot comprising one or more barrier elements, a processing unit operable to identify one or more boundaries in a real environment and/or a virtual environment, the boundaries corresponding to a predetermined extent of allowed motion in that environment, and a control unit operable to control the robot such that at least one barrier element is arranged at a position corresponding to one of the identified boundaries.

Abstract: A system for generating an input signal for a video game includes: a receiving unit configured to receive a video game output signal output by a video game playing device during the playing of a video game; a reasoning model configured to determine an action to take within the video game based on the received video game output signal, the reasoning model being configured to generate a representation of the determined action that is independent of the video game; and an encoding unit configured to translate the representation into an input signal and to provide the input signal to a video game playing device at which the video game is being played, thereby causing the determined action to be performed within the video game.

Abstract: A system for improving a discovery process for a virtual environment, the system comprising an environment discovery unit operable to perform a discovery process comprising navigation of the virtual environment and identification of one or more aspects of the virtual environment, a performance analysis unit operable to evaluate the effectiveness of the discovery process, and a discovery update unit operable to modify future operation of the environment discovery unit in dependence upon the evaluation.

Abstract: A method comprises generating a first environment representation for rendering a video representation of a virtual environment; and generating a second environment representation for rendering an audio output at a virtual listening position within the virtual environment in response to sounds generated by one or more virtual sound sources within the virtual environment; in which the first and second environment representations comprise respective different geometrical representations of the virtual environment; in which the step of generating the second environment representation comprises: generating a starting version of the second environment representation; and modifying the starting version of the second environment representation.

Abstract: An audio personalisation method for a user, to reproduce an area-based or volumetric sound source, includes the steps of, for a head related transfer function ‘HRTF’ associated with the user, smoothing HRTF coefficients relating to peaks and notches in the HRTF's spectral response, responsive to the size of the area or volume of the sound source; filtering the sound source using the smoothed HRTF for the notional position of the sound source; and outputting the filtered sound source signal for playback to the user.

Abstract: A digital model repair method includes: providing a point cloud digital model of a target object as input to a generative network of a trained generative adversarial network ‘GAN’, the input point cloud comprising a plurality of points erroneously perturbed by one or more causes, and generating, by the generative network of the GAN, an output point cloud in which the erroneous perturbation of some or all of the plurality of points has been reduced; where the generative network of the GAN was trained using input point clouds comprising a plurality of points erroneously perturbed by said one or more causes, and a discriminator of the GAN was trained to distinguish point clouds comprising a plurality of points erroneously perturbed by said one or more causes and point clouds substantially without such perturbations.

Abstract: A system for training a model to select actions to be taken by an agent within an environment, the system including: a state determination unit operable to determine a state of the environment, a latency determination unit operable to determine a latency associated with interactions between the agent and the environment, an action determination unit operable to determine one or more actions to be performed by the agent in dependence upon the state, wherein actions are determined for each of one or more latencies determined by the latency determination unit, an action evaluation unit operable to evaluate the success of each of the actions, and a generation unit operable to generate the model in dependence upon identifying correlations between the success of each of the actions and the determined latency associated with those actions, so as to identify an action to be taken by the agent in dependence upon both a determined state and a latency.
